The tunes are quite easy to pick up - I especially liked ‘I Say A Little Prayer For You’ and ‘Heard It Through The Grapevine’ which are also very good arrangements for alto sax and pitched in the right key. With this book you will learn to relax and not panic so much at what look like awkward rhythms - as the sound just seems to come naturally. This book is good for practicing various tone styles that you are thinking of adopting.

One of the better books in the Guestspot range. I found it a real treat to be able to play reading the dots and then given a little freedom to improvise. I would thoroughly recommend this book if you are looking for something that is going to take you away from the norm and want to play something that's going to introduce you to jazz improvisation.
